Although the vicissitudes of life, the wind and rain erosion, the Xincai Confucian Temple still maintains the characteristics of ancient architecture, and is now listed as a provincial cultural relics protection unit. The Confucius bronze statue in Dacheng Hall of Xincai Confucian Temple is the only bronze statue of Confucius in the Ming Dynasty in China, which can be called a national treasure!
